Transaction 435a427d7ce6cf39a1f3b5f9e62c1d62ffcf6811fd7ac9d2d308ae31652f491f

2 Input
1 Outputs
  • 435a427d7ce6cf39a1f3b5f9e62c1d62ffcf6811fd7ac9d2d308ae31652f491f:0
  • value  2649220
    address  37wP9mhuTTiWAfCzEwKqQyEryCo87PQPVw